  • Challenge:

    Paradigm is the North American digital, PR and XM AOR for Playtex Baby, a leading baby products brand. As a Toronto based digital agency, Paradigm is responsible for digital marketing services including creative, social content, media buying, community management, video, photography and influencer marketing in the US and Canada.

    The ongoing challenge is in positioning the Playtex Baby brand as relevant to prenatal and new moms, in a limited budget environment where there are larger competitors, with deep pockets, taking market share away from the 50-year-old brand.

    Solution:

    The brand’s target audience is prenatal and new moms – two groups with significantly above average time spent on social media platforms. As a result, Paradigm’s digital marketing strategy is to focus largely on social media platforms to connect with the core audience, with additional spend focused on targeted publishers in the baby space. Paradigm employs a high touch strategy for the brand’s social platforms.

    Digital creative development and media buying are executed together to ensure maximum optimization against best performing content and maximum flexibility – quick creative enhancements and ongoing analytics ensure budget is consistently outperforming in terms of ROI.

    Contests, promotions and giveaways feature heavily in organic content as a means to engage with the community and demonstrate brand value and relevance.

    Influencers, called #PlaytexMoms, are featured in takeovers and static posts designed to drive sales and reinforce brand relevance.

    Results:

    Paradigm’s digital media strategy has continually outperformed the previous year’s results, despite a declining year over year overall spend. In the first half of 2020, there were more than 21 million impressions with close to 100,000 link clicks to retail and a solid return on ad spend, despite a significantly scaled back budget.

    Organic content reinforces brand relevance and consistently outperforms industry standards on both Facebook and Instagram – with the brand’s unique “Momtras” and video content generating the highest engagement.

    Challenge:

    The election of a new government in Alberta presented a prime opportunity to motivate politicians to consider changes to the Property & Casualty Insurance industry in Alberta. The industry wanted to open the door to discussions about regulatory change needed to improve the customer experience for Alberta drivers.

    There was a need to demonstrate to government that the industry is hampered by excessive and outdated regulations, and that there are immediate benefits to consumers if regulations were changed to allow for innovation.

    As a Toronto-based digital marketing agency, Paradigm was tasked with creating a campaign that would motivate changes to auto insurance regulations in Alberta.

    Solution:

    To create a compelling campaign that reinforced the benefits of change to government and Albertan drivers, Paradigm developed The MOOT (Museum of Outdated Technology), a fictional gallery showcasing the best in obsolete items, including insurance paperwork.

    The MOOT was brought to life through a digital video and series of social posts with a supporting media buy that geotargeted the legislature in Edmonton, using Facebook and Twitter, to reach key politicians and stakeholders by job title and interest targeting on LinkedIn.

    Results:

    Reaching politicians with a humorous message worked. On August 12, 2019, the Alberta government announced it was changing auto insurance regulations, allowing insurance companies in the province to move to electronic proof of insurance.

    On October 11, the government amended the Fair Practices Regulations to allow insurers to send notice of policy cancellations electronically. Insurance Bureau of Canada advocated for this change in tandem with advocating for digital pink slips. These two changes made Alberta the first province in Canada able to provide a fully digital insurance experience to consumers.
